Description
Petitioners
Merchants of Florence living in England.
Addressees
King and lords in the present parliament.
Nature of request
The merchants of Florence living in England state that a subsidy on wools and woolfells granted in the last parliament at Coventry is higher than they paid previously, and ask that they might be allowed to pay the previous lower sum.
Nature of endorsement
The king, with the assent of the lords spiritual and temporal has granted that the merchants of Florence named in this petition shall not pay, and that none of them shall pay, more than a subsidy of 50s. on each sack of wool, and 50s. on each 240 woolfells to be shipped or sent by them out of the realm of England from 1 February last, or henceforth to be shipped or sent by them out of the same realm, notwithstanding the statute or grant made in the last parliament at Coventry, in which it is contained that the said merchants should pay 53s. 4d. for each sack of wool which they would send out of the realm, and also 53s. 4d. for each 240 woolfells which they would send out of the realm; and the king of his special grace, with the advice and assent of the aforesaid lords has released and pardoned to the said merchants of Florence and to each of them the increase of 3s. 4d. on the aforesaid subsidy, from the aforesaid 1 February.
Places mentioned
Florence [Italy]
Coventry, [Warwickshire].
Note
The petition dates to 1406 as an entry in the patent rolls dated at Westminster on 7 June 1406 is clearly in response to this petition (CPR 1405-8, p.197).
